Gopaul
English
Etymology
Variant of Gopal. This surname is typical of Mauritius and Trinidad and Tobago.
Statistics
- According to the 2010 United States Census, Gopaul is the 33772th most common surname in the United States, belonging to 674 individuals. Gopaul is most common among Black/African American (40.8%) and Asian/Pacific Islander (34.57%) individuals.
